Inventory managers in Ireland are responsible for overseeing the tracking, storage, and control of all order, stock, and inventory functions within their organization. This includes overseeing the processes of tracking incoming and outgoing inventory, stocking materials and products, and monitoring inventory levels. The perfect inventory manager for an Ireland-based business will be able to accurately track and report inventory-related activities, to ensure that optimal inventory levels are maintained and any discrepancies are managed and resolved. In this role, you’ll use an in-depth understanding of key inventory management principles, such as Just-in-time and Kanban, to ensure inventory accuracy and performance. As an inventory manager, you’ll also need to be able to assess the needs of the business, monitor inventory levels, and make recommendations based on inventory data and results. In addition, you’ll be responsible for maintaining relationships with suppliers and monitors inventory-related expenditures to maintain sustainability and cost-effectiveness.
